The ingredients needed to make Rice Flour Pancakes for Babies with No Baking Powder:
- Take 100 grams Rice flour
- Provide 1 Egg
- You need 100 ml Milk or soy milk
- Provide 5 grams Canola oil or olive oil
- Prepare 1 tbsp plus, Sugar
Steps to make Rice Flour Pancakes for Babies with No Baking Powder:
- Break the egg in a bowl and beat with a whisk.
- Mix in the sugar, canola oil, and milk.
- Add in the rice flour.
- Cook the pancakes in a heated frying pan without oil (or you can make one pancake at a time).
- Once the pancakes begin to bubble, flip them over. When both sides have browned, they're done.
- Optionally top with butter, honey, etc.
- They are perfect for my 1 year old son's breakfast too.
